Summary

HP18 9QB is a primarily residential postcode in Oakley, Buckinghamshire. It was first introduced in January 1980.

The most common council tax bands are G and E.

Residential buildings are primarily detached. Domestic properties are mostly bungalows and houses.

Estimated residential property values, based on historical transactions and adjusted for inflation, range from £369,925 to £683,543 with an average of £491,791.

None of the residential properties sold since 1995 have been new builds or newly converted.

Domestic properties are predominantly owner occupied.

The most common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) ratings are F and D.

The average commercial rateable value is £9,100. The most common recorded business type is Public House.

In the 2011 census, there were 16 people resident in HP18 9QB, of which 8 were male and 8 were female. This also includes overnight visitors at domestic properties, and residents of non-domestic properties such as hotels, prisons and halls of residence.

HP18 9QB is in the Oxford travel to work area. NHS services are provided by the Buckinghamshire Primary Care Trust.

HP18 9QB is approximately 88m (289ft) above sea level.
